The Heartfelt Meaning Behind "Loud Little Town"

"Loud Little Town" stands out on the *A Philly Special Christmas Party* album not just because it’s a duet, but because of its raw, relatable narrative about the evolution of family life. The song, a gentle, acoustic-driven track, was specifically written to reflect the Kelce’s personal experiences during the holiday season.

The Poetic Juxtaposition of Quiet and Chaos

The title itself, "Loud Little Town," is a clever, poetic contradiction. It speaks to the Kelce’s home life—a "little town" of their own, which is simultaneously "loud" due to the presence of four young daughters. The lyrics beautifully capture this transition:

"There were little feet on our wooden floor as you hung the wreath upon the door / In a lover's light, in a lover's light."

This opening verse, sung by Jason, evokes the memory of their early Christmases as a couple—the quiet, romantic, "lover's light" phase. Kylie's subsequent verses and the chorus then shift to the current reality, acknowledging the noise and chaos that comes with children, yet framing it as the true source of holiday magic. It’s an ode to the beautiful noise of a growing family, a sentiment that resonates deeply with parents everywhere.

The Songwriter and The Sound

The track was penned by Philadelphia-based musician Brandon Beaver, known for his work with the band The Innocence Mission. Beaver’s contribution ensured the song had an authentic, indie-folk sound that contrasts with the album's more traditional or rock-oriented holiday covers. The song's tender arrangement and the genuine, if slightly unpolished, vocal delivery from both Jason and Kylie Kelce give it a unique charm. It’s an honest portrayal of two people singing about their life, not two professional singers trying to hit a high note.

The Legacy of The Philly Specials: Charity, Music, and the Final Album

"Loud Little Town" is a key track on the third and final album from The Philly Specials, a musical supergroup consisting of Philadelphia Eagles offensive linemen: Jason Kelce, Lane Johnson (Right Tackle), and Jordan Mailata (Left Tackle). This project has grown into a significant cultural and charitable phenomenon.

The Christmas Trilogy: A Philly Special Christmas Party

The 2024 album, *A Philly Special Christmas Party*, marks the conclusion of a beloved three-year Christmas music tradition. The album features a mix of classic holiday covers and original songs, all produced by Vera Y Records. The tracklist is packed with festive cheer and impressive collaborations, showcasing the linemen's surprising musical talent.

Key Tracks on *A Philly Special Christmas Party* (2024):

  • "Last Christmas"
  • "Rudolph The Red-Nosed Reindeer"
  • "It's Christmas Time (In Cleveland Heights)" (Featuring Zach Miller, a nod to Jason's hometown)
  • "Loud Little Town" (Featuring Kylie Kelce)
  • "Pretty Paper" (Featuring Lane Johnson)
  • "Christmas (Baby Please Come Home)"
  • "This Christmas"

The Charitable Impact on Philadelphia

The primary motivation behind The Philly Specials’ entire Christmas trilogy has always been charity. The project has raised millions of dollars for children and families in need across the Philadelphia region, a cause deeply personal to both Jason and Kylie Kelce.

All profits generated from the sales of the 2024 album, including vinyl, CD, and digital downloads, are donated directly to Philadelphia Area Charities that specifically support children. This commitment to giving back, especially through a fun and unexpected medium like a holiday album, has made the Kelce family and The Philly Specials enduring heroes in the city, extending their legacy far beyond their Super Bowl LII victory. This charitable focus provides the ultimate, heartwarming context for the intimate nature of "Loud Little Town"—the song is a gift to their family, and the proceeds are a gift to their community.
